const (
IPv4ZeroCIDR = "0.0.0.0/0"
IPv6ZeroCIDR = "::/0"
)
func IsZeroCIDR(cidr string) bool {
if cidr == IPv4ZeroCIDR || cidr == IPv6ZeroCIDR {
return true
}
return false
}

// GetNodeAddresses return all matched node IP addresses based on given cidr slice.
// Some callers, e.g. IPVS proxier, need concrete IPs, not ranges, which is why this exists.
// NetworkInterfacer is injected for test purpose.
// We expect the cidrs passed in is already validated.
// Given an empty input `[]`, it will return `0.0.0.0/0` and `::/0` directly.
// If multiple cidrs is given, it will return the minimal IP sets, e.g. given input `[1.2.0.0/16, 0.0.0.0/0]`, it will
// only return `0.0.0.0/0`.
// NOTE: GetNodeAddresses only accepts CIDRs, if you want concrete IPs, e.g. 1.2.3.4, then the input should be 1.2.3.4/32.
func GetNodeAddresses(cidrs []string, nw NetworkInterfacer) (sets.String, error) {
uniqueAddressList := sets.NewString()
if len(cidrs) == 0 {
uniqueAddressList.Insert(IPv4ZeroCIDR)
uniqueAddressList.Insert(IPv6ZeroCIDR)
return uniqueAddressList, nil
}
// First round of iteration to pick out `0.0.0.0/0` or `::/0` for the sake of excluding non-zero IPs.
for _, cidr := range cidrs {
if IsZeroCIDR(cidr) {
uniqueAddressList.Insert(cidr)
}
}
// Second round of iteration to parse IPs based on cidr.
for _, cidr := range cidrs {
if IsZeroCIDR(cidr) {
continue
}
_, ipNet, _ := net.ParseCIDR(cidr)
itfs, err := nw.Interfaces()
if err != nil {
return nil, fmt.Errorf("error listing all interfaces from host, error: %v", err)
}
for _, itf := range itfs {
addrs, err := nw.Addrs(&itf)
if err != nil {
return nil, fmt.Errorf("error getting address from interface %s, error: %v", itf.Name, err)
}
for _, addr := range addrs {
if addr == nil {
continue
}
ip, _, err := net.ParseCIDR(addr.String())
if err != nil {
return nil, fmt.Errorf("error parsing CIDR for interface %s, error: %v", itf.Name, err)
}
if ipNet.Contains(ip) {
if utilnet.IsIPv6(ip) && !uniqueAddressList.Has(IPv6ZeroCIDR) {
uniqueAddressList.Insert(ip.String())
}
if !utilnet.IsIPv6(ip) && !uniqueAddressList.Has(IPv4ZeroCIDR) {
uniqueAddressList.Insert(ip.String())
}
}
}
}
}
return uniqueAddressList, nil
}
